If you haven't got it already, you will need the latest version of the Focusrite Control software. This step is crucial and it is required for the interface to perform properly with your device.
You can find the latest version here. Make sure to install the correct one (Mac or PC) for your device: Clarett 4 PRE USB or Scarlett 18i20.
Once downloaded and installed, close all other apps and leave open Focusrite Control only.
Click 'File' > 'Restore Factory Defaults' > OK - this will reset the interface to factory settings.
If prompted to choose a Preset, click off that window instead.
Make sure that your Audio Input and Output routing on your device's audio settings and your DAW audio settings are assigned to your interface.
FL Studio and Windows users: Select 'FOCUSRITE USB ASIO' as your audio driver.

TIPS
- Reset the interface every session to cancel any previous routings.
- Check the 3 green lights are on when your laptop is plugged into the interface. If the USB light isn’t on, chances are you’ve got the wrong USB cable plugged in.
- Ensure the yellow cables are plugged into LINE OUTPUTS 1-2. If they're in LINE OUTPUTS 3-4 (easily done) then the interface ignores the master volume control and sends out audio at max gain, bad for ears and gear!
